    Anyone else have 3G issues at their home?

    My phone stays connected to 3G at my house even though I only get one bar, as soon I get a call it gets dropped because the phone tries to switch to Edge. So I have to turn off 3G on my whenever I'm home if I want to recieve call, a real PITA.

    Anyone else have issue with ATT & 3G?

    Anyone else have 3G issues at their home?

    If you are in a fringe 3G area, the only way to have good conversation, is to disable 3G.
    It also save battery by not changing back and forth from edge to 3G. Until AT&T has total coverage with 3G, you have no choice.
